Abstract

The essential results of the project were: changing the mix compositions (gradation and binder content), identifying that anti-stripping agent must usually be used in a foam stabilization mixture, changing methods in specimen preparation and mix design, changing test methods, confirming the dominating effect of compacting to quality both in the laboratory and on site, identifying that the number of freeze-thaw cycles has a significant effect on the stiffness modulus and consistency of deformation resistance, producing research material for the basis of the requirements readjustment for stabilizations, obtaining reference data for possible product approval studies of stabilizations, developing service life evaluation methods for stabilizations.
